409.205 409.205(1) (1) When security interest not invalid or fraudulent. A security interest is not invalid or fraudulent against creditors solely because: 409.205(1)(a) (a) The debtor has the right or ability to: 409.205(1)(a)1.

1.Use, commingle, or dispose of all or part of the collateral, including returned or repossessed goods; 409.205(1)(a)2.
2.Collect, compromise, enforce, or otherwise deal with collateral; 409.205(1)(a)3.
3.Accept the return of collateral or make repossessions; or 409.205(1)(a)4.
